探索Postman的工作流:从请求到集成

作者:谁偷走了我的奶酪2024.01.29 21:26浏览量:2

简介:Postman是一款强大的API开发工具,通过其工作流,用户可以高效地测试和集成API。本文将详细介绍Postman的工作流程,包括请求、集合、区块和环境等组成部分,以及如何通过测试和集成来验证API的正确性。

在开发、测试和集成API的过程中,Postman提供了一套完整的工作流,使得用户可以高效地管理请求、测试和集成。本文将详细介绍Postman的工作流程,包括请求、集合、区块和环境等组成部分,以及如何通过测试和集成来验证API的正确性。
一、了解Postman的主要组成部分

  1. 请求(Requests):在Postman中,请求是测试API的基础。用户需要创建一个新的请求,包括输入URL、选择HTTP方法(例如GET、POST、PUT、DELETE等)以及输入数据来填充请求。
  2. 集合(Collections):集合是一组相关的请求。在开发过程中,用户可以将相关的请求组织到一个集合中,以便于管理和运行。
  3. 区块(Blocks):区块是用于组织请求的一种方式。用户可以将请求按照功能或业务逻辑分组到不同的区块中,以便于理解和维护。
  4. 环境(Environments):环境是用于管理不同环境下的变量。用户可以在不同的环境(例如开发、测试、生产等)下定义不同的变量,以便于控制请求中的参数值。
    二、Postman的工作流程
  5. 创建请求:首先,用户需要创建一个新的请求。在Postman中,可以通过点击左上角的“New Request”按钮来创建一个新的请求。然后,输入URL、选择HTTP方法和输入数据来填充请求。
  6. 创建测试脚本:接下来,用户需要编写测试脚本以验证API的正确性。在Postman中,可以使用JavaScript编写测试脚本。测试脚本可以检查响应的状态码、响应时间、响应体等内容是否符合预期结果。
  7. 组织请求到集合:一旦创建了请求和测试脚本,用户可以将这些请求组织到一个集合中。在Postman中,可以通过点击“Collections”选项卡来创建和管理集合。可以将相关的请求拖拽到集合中,也可以通过右键单击请求选择“Add to Collection”来添加到集合中。
  8. 创建环境并设置变量:在开发过程中,用户可能需要为不同的环境设置不同的变量值。在Postman中,可以通过点击“Environment”选项卡来创建和管理环境。在环境编辑器中,可以定义变量并为其设置值。在发送请求时,可以通过{{variable_name}}的形式引用环境中的变量值。
  9. 运行测试:一旦设置了请求、测试脚本和环境变量,用户可以运行测试来验证API的正确性。在Postman中,可以通过点击“Run”按钮来运行测试。可以选择单个请求或整个集合进行测试。运行测试后,Postman会显示每个请求的详细结果,包括状态码、响应时间、响应体等内容。
  10. 集成API:最后,当API开发完成后,用户可以将这些API集成到自己的应用程序中。在Postman中,可以通过点击“Integrations”选项卡来查看和管理已集成的API。用户可以将API集成到自己的应用程序中,以便于自动化测试和生产环境下的调用。
    总结:通过了解Postman的工作流程,用户可以更好地管理API的开发、测试和集成过程。通过创建请求、编写测试脚本、组织请求到集合、设置环境变量和运行测试,用户可以确保API的正确性和稳定性。最后,通过集成API到自己的应用程序中,用户可以自动化测试和生产环境下的调用过程。